2007 Pintas vintage port
Yojng red colour, revealing crushed nettles on the nose over a very sharp cranberry. Surprisingly sweet on the palate, with dry tannins everywhere. Plenty of fruit in the mouth and an acidity in proper balance to the other components. Superb blueberry fruit. A dry aftertaste, with a tingling startand then a lovely lingering finish, which fades quickly. 86-88. Drunk 26 June 2009.
